When buying shoes for the kids, remember the growth factor. Get some with a bit over a thumb’s width near the end of the kid’s big toe in the shoe. That way, there will be room for the foot to grow without the shoe being too large. A salesman can help, too.

Before you buy shoes for exercising, find out what type of arch you have because different athletic shoes fit different arch types. One way to do this is to moisten your feet then place your feet on a sheet of plain paper. The parts that show up wet will reveal your arch type. If you have flat arches then the whole footprint will show. If you can’t see the middle, then you have a high arch. This can be helpful when you are looking for a shoe that will fit comfortably.

There should be a half inch space in-between your shoe and the tip of your foot. This space can be measured by pressing a thumb in a sideways manner on your foot’s top. If the space between your toe and the end of the shoe is greater or less than a half inch, request a different size.
